Hi all,

It's my pleasure to nominate Nitin Dahyabhai as a new member of WTP's PMC.

Nitin has had a long history with WTP. He has been the lead for the Source Editing project as well as committers in other WTP projects including Web Tools Common and _javascript_ Development Tools. He is active in the WTP community and his input to the WTP PMC board will be beneficial to the project.

Due to recent change in my focus of my responsibilities at IBM, I cannot be as active as before in the WTP project. It is better for me to step down from the WTP PMC lead role. I'll continue to serve the WTP community by continuing my WTP PMC member and WTP Server Tools lead responsibilities. I just don't have enough bandwidth to continue my PMC lead role. After discussion with some other active PMC members, I nominate Nitin Dahyabhai as the new WTP PMC lead. Nitin will be an excellent successor to help the Web Tools Platform moving forward.

Here's my vote:

+1 to PMC membership for Nitin Dahyabhai
+1 to PMC lead for Nitin Dahyabhai

As stated in our PMC policy document[1], after being voted in, we'll notify the EMO for approval
